Haberdasher (San Jose) - https://haberdashersj.com/#

Speak-easy style cocktail bar in a basement with relaxed ambience and dark lighting (as one can see from the quite dark pictures). Overall very well thought out and executed cocktails (even though I was bit surprised to see some bartenders free pour sometimes instead of a jigger which tends to make consistency challenging)
One of the best cocktail bars in San Jose

Pagoda - gin, yuzu liqueur, thai basil syrup, lemon, house-made basil oil drops


Year of the Snake - Santa Teresa rum, Pedro Ximenez sherry, fig syrup, lime, Chinese 5-spice bitters


Mariposa (N/A) - Seedlip Grove 42, elderflower, house-made mint syrup, fresh lemon, pinch of salt

I went to the Phone Booth at S. Van Ness and 25th Street in the Mission late last Sunday. It’s a dive, cash only.

This was my first visit. I had a Martini, which I think was $12. I had it with Beefeater gin and a twist. It was quite large, quite cold, and quite nice.
